NEW DELHI: Even as Congress MP Mohammad Azharuddin reached an out-of-court settlement in a cheque bounce case filed against him, his non-appearance before the court on Wednesday irked the judge, who slapped a cost of Rs 15 lakh on him for showing “utter disdain” to it by not appearing and “wasting” the judicial time.
Metropolitan magistrate Vikrant Vaid imposed the cost after being informed by the former cricketer’s counsel that he had amicably arrived at an out-of-court settlement.
“If settlement had to be done, it could have been done on the first date itself,” the court said. tnn
